it's 55 miles from Key Biscayne to Bimini. Why did it take 3.5 hours to get there? Where you stopped a lot? Also, did you have GPS that you were following or did you just follow the lead boat?
@WeekendersontheWater27 күн бұрын
The group was moving fairly slow. It was a bit of a rough day to start out, and we were only heading about 20 mph. We stopped for about 20 minutes in the middle, and again another 10 minutes to afix our flags. I personally did not have a GPS, but I have navtronics on my phone which works an airplane mode, and a VHF radio with GPS coordinates as well. And of course we had a personal locator beacon each. But as far as navigation goes, I just followed the ski in front of me.

Awesome video I hope to do this one day. What’s the protocol when someone’s ski breaks down?
@WeekendersontheWater27 күн бұрын
That is a difficult topic. We were lucky to not have anyone break down during the ride. There were a few issues on the island. One guy had to get his ski shipped home. Another managed to fix it on the island. I've heard on other groups that some times they just let the skis go if the start to sink, and follow up with their insurance company. Because I have two, my plan was to tow one with the other of needed.

how many gallons and how many miles do you get on the ski itself ?
@WeekendersontheWaterАй бұрын
These GTIs have a 16 gallon tank. Depending on how hard you ride and conditions it can vary between 60 and 100 miles on a full tank.
